Carbon Footprints, Local Steps

Thursday, 11th October 2007, 6:30 pm
A new report published by the "New Local Government Network" argues that the Government goal of 60 percent carbon dioxide reduction can be achieved 25 years earlier than currently forecast. It claims that local councils could introduce measures that would save 320 million tonnes of CO2 emissions by 2025.

Finding the Energy: Domestic Microgeneration and Planning

Thursday, 30th August 2007, 1:58 pm
A pamphlet published by the New Local Government Network has called for local planning laws to be relaxed to allow more people the option of installing eco-friendly energy sources to their homes.

Pay as you Throw

Wednesday, 22nd August 2007, 5:07 pm
The Local Government Association today published specific proposals on how 'save as you throw' schemes could work in practice in some parts of the country - and made a firm commitment that local authorities would not use it as a stealth tax to raise extra cash and that any scheme should be supported by local people.
